How to get from Bristol to Princeton by bus and train?
By bus and train
To get from Bristol to Princeton in Philadelphia,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the 129 bus from Bucks County Office Center station to Beaver St & Garden St - Mbns station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the TRE train and finally take the 606 bus from S Clinton Ave at Wallenberg Ave station to Nassau St at S Tulane St station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 58 min.
